Fiji coup leader gets signs of support
Dec 8 2006 1:26PM (CT)
SUVA, Fiji (AP) - The leader of Fiji's coup received signs of domestic support from tribal chiefs and a major opposition party Friday, but the British Commonwealth suspended the Pacific island nation in the latest international repudiation of the caretaker government.

Thousands battle fires in Australia
Dec 8 2006 9:33AM (CT)
MELBOURNE, Australia (AP) - Thousands of firefighters rushed to contain more than a dozen wildfires burning across southern Australia on Friday amid fears that high temperatures and gusty winds forecast this weekend could further stoke the blazes, threatening farms and towns.

Australia wants its troops out of Iraq
Dec 8 2006 2:22AM (CT)
CANBERRA, Australia (AP) - Prime Minister John Howard, responding to the Iraq Study Group report, said Friday he would like to see Australian troops out of Iraq but refused to set a deadline for their withdrawal.
